Hi Anna,

That is a very keen observation and I wanted to let everyone know that NALTEA is working on putting together some very low-cost, and informal regional gatherings to help bring local abstractors together.  As a test, NALTEA has been working with Jan Forster in North Carolina.  Jan approached the board with the idea of holding a "Title Camp" and we are all very excited about it. 

Basically, Title Camp will give local abstractors the chance to build networks and discuss challenges that affect them locally.  It will also be a excellent opportunity for more abstractors who are unable to attend NALTEA's national conferences to learn more about the national organization and help address those issues which are beyond their local reach.

The details are still being worked out, but the first Title Camp is being planned for October 21 in the Myrtle Beach, NC area.  Jan is organizing it with some assistance from NALTEA and if everything goes well I'm sure NALTEA will work with others to expand the Title Camp concept across the country. 

More information will be formally presented soon.  We will keep you all posted.
